Cigarettes (Regulation of Production, Supply and Distribution) Act, 1975 [Repealed] Section 22

Title: Act Not to Apply to Cigarettes Which Are Exported

State: Central

Year: 1975

Nothing contained in this Act shall apply to any cigarette or package of cigarettes which is exported: PROVIDED that nothing in this sectionshall be deemed to authorise the export of any package of cigarettes, not containing the specified warning to any country if the law in force in that country requires that the same or similar warning shall be specified on each package of cigarettes.

Tobacco Board Act, 1975 Section 20

Title: Power to Prohibit or Control Import and Export of Tobacco and Tobacco Products

State: Central

Year: 1975

(1) The Central Government may, by order published in the Official Gazette, make provision for prohibiting, restricting or otherwise controlling the import or export of tobacco and tobacco products, either generally or in specified classes of cases. (2) All tobacco and tobacco products to which any order under sub-section (1) applies, shall be deemed to be goods of which the import or export has been prohibited under section 11 of the Customs Act, 1962, and all the provisions of that Act shall have effect accordingly. (3) If any person contravenes any order made under sub-section (1), he shall, without prejudice to any confiscation or penalty to which he may be liable under the provisions of the Customs Act, 1962 as applied by sub-section (2), be punishable with imprisonment for a term which may extend to one year; or with fine or with both.

Customs Tariff Act 1975 Section 8

Title: Emergency Power of Central Government to Increase or Levy Export Duties

State: Central

Year: 1975

(1) Where, in respect of any article, whether included in the Second Schedule or not, the Central Government is satisfied that the export duty leviable thereon should be increased or that an export duty should be levied, and that circumstances exist which render it necessary to take immediate action, the Central Government may, by notification in the Official Gazette, direct an amendment of the Second Schedule to be made so as to provide for an increase in the export duty leviable or, as the case may be, for the levy of an export duty, on that article. (2) The provisions of sub-sections (3) and (4) of Section 7 shall apply to any notification issued under sub-section (1) as they apply in relation to any notification increasing duty issued under sub-section (2) of Section 7.

Tobacco Board Act, 1975 Section 12

Title: Registration of Exporters, Packers, Auctioneers and Dealers

State: Central

Year: 1975

No person shall export tobacco or any tobacco products or function as a packer, auctioneer of, or dealer in, tobacco unless he registers with the Board in accordance with the rules made under this Act.
